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ost In Silver Cliff, CO

The cost of tile floor water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Silver Cliff, CO.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of tile floor water damage restoration: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Disinfection and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Repair or replacement of damaged tile or flooring $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, severity of damage
Final walkthrough and inspection $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of damage

Q: How do I prevent tile floor water damage in the future?

A: There are several steps you can take to prevent tile floor water damage in the future. These include regularly checking your pipes for leaks, ensuring that your roof is in good condition, and keeping an eye out for signs of water damage.
